ZigbeX Photo Diode

• Photo diode CDS – named CDS is connected to INT0 & ADC0 on Atmega

128(8bit CPU)– CDS inputs resistance value varying on light strength– Output to ADC0

• Light Sensor Component– Photo component

Photo component

• ADCC component– Photo component needs to uses upper level component

ADCC.

  ADCC functions

Get data from ADC

  ADC.getData() – read data from ADC port(command).

 event ADC.dataReady(uint16_t data) – event delibers.

Oscilloscope.nc

• Oscilloscope.nc – Osilloscope components

• UART Comm – connecting to PC• DemoSensorC- Get the light data• TimerC & LedsC

configuration Oscilloscope { } implementation  {    components Main, OscilloscopeM, TimerC, LedsC,                DemoSensorC as Sensor, UARTComm as Comm;

   Main.StdControl ‐> OscilloscopeM;    Main.StdControl ‐> TimerC;    OscilloscopeM.Timer ‐> TimerC.Timer[unique("Timer")];    OscilloscopeM.Leds ‐> LedsC;    OscilloscopeM.ADC ‐> Sensor;    … }

Serial Comm.

• UARTComm component– UARTComm provides ReceiveMsg interface and SendMsg

interface.

  

UARTComm functions 

 ReceiveMsg event TOS_MsgPtr receive(TOS_MsgPtr m) – received from PC with event type, and message type is TOS_Msg

 SendMsg send(...) – sense mode to PC, passes TOS_Msg sendDone(...) - send(...) - when done, tells by event type

OscilloscopeM.nc

• OscilloscopeM.nc (2)

command result_t StdControl.start() {     call SensorControl.start();     call Timer.start(TIMER_REPEAT, 125);     call CommControl.start();     return SUCCESS;   }

command result_t StdControl.stop() {     … return SUCCESS; }

event result_t Timer.fired() {     return call ADC.getData();  }

OscilloscopeM.nc

• OscilloscopeM.nc (3)

async event result_t ADC.dataReady (uint16_t data) {     struct OscopeMsg *pack;     atomic {       pack = (struct OscopeMsg *) msg[currentMsg].data;       pack‐>data[packetReadingNumber++] = data;       readingNumber++;       dbg(DBG_USR1, "data_event\n");       if (packetReadingNumber == BUFFER_SIZE) {     post dataTask();       }     }     if (data > 0x0300)       call Leds.redOn();     else       call Leds.redOff();

    return SUCCESS;   }

OscilloscopeM.nc

• OscilloscopeM.nc (4)task void dataTask()  {     struct OscopeMsg *pack;     atomic {       pack = (struct OscopeMsg *)msg[currentMsg].data;       packetReadingNumber = 0;       pack‐>lastSampleNumber = readingNumber;     }     pack‐>channel = 1;     pack‐>sourceMoteID = TOS_LOCAL_ADDRESS;     if (call DataMsg.send(TOS_UART_ADDR, sizeof(struct OscopeMsg), &msg[currentMsg]))     {        atomic { currentMsg ^= 0x1; }        call Leds.yellowToggle();      }  }  event result_t DataMsg.sendDone (TOS_MsgPtr sent, result_t success) {     return SUCCESS;  }
